In January I drove by Ken Garff on Redwood Road. They were advertising $99 down and $99 a month. There sign did not mention anything about credit.
Later that evening I go email their dealership and tell them that I am interested. Of course they tell me to rush down. I go down and after they check my credit they say the $99 down was not available to me, but they could get me into a car for about $150 a month.
I ended up with a Cavalier and financed at $230 a month. They kept trying to give me a guilt trip and say cause I was so young and my credit wasn't perfect I should pay more. As only used car salemen can do, they lied and did everything but cross the line of puffery and fraud.

I took they car home that night thinking I had been financed. A few days later I was called and told that I was denied financing and I was to be bring the car in immediately and pay for the miles I had already put on it.

They probably knew I was not financed and they planned to make a few hundred dollars off of me anyways by letting me run up the miles and then having me pay for it.

Well I found my own financing and sent them the check. I will NEVER do business with Ken Garff again.
